Security

There are many security features that can be added to UPVC doors to help safeguard your home. These features are affordable, simple to use, and affordable. However, they aren't able to guarantee 100% protection.

The criminals always search for ways to gain access. The most popular strategy used by burglars is to break into the replacing Lock on Upvc door. There is a greater chance of preventing this type break-in when you have an anti-snap lock.

Another strategy is to break in with a heavy object. It is extremely difficult to prevent. Without an alarm system that is monitored you won't be in a position to safeguard your home.

It is an excellent idea to put security bars on your patio door to guard it. You can put them in place before you go to bed and also before you leave. Doors are especially vulnerable during the night.

Hinge bolts are yet another important measure to consider. A hinge bolt is a good option, especially if your door has an opening to the outside.

Door chains can also be beneficial for securing your UPVC doors. However, they cannot stand up to full force kicks or ramming assaults.

If your door is equipped with a glass panel you can put in a shatterproof layer. There are many types of shatterproof film available. You can pick the one that meets your requirements best. Some are translucent, while others are tinted.

Security cameras are a great method to catch burglars in the act. You can also install a motion-activated lighting system that doesn't require wiring. In addition, you could install security lighting to scare off intruders.

Although no security measure is guaranteed to be foolproof however, you can lessen your risk by taking right steps to protect your home.
